PG电子机制,游戏开发中的核心数据管理方案pg电子机制

PG电子机制,游戏开发中的核心数据管理方案pg电子机制,

本文目录导读:

  1. PG电子机制的基本概念
  2. PG电子机制的实现方式
  3. PG电子机制在游戏开发中的应用
  4. PG电子机制的优缺点
  5. PG电子机制的未来发展

随着电子游戏的不断发展,游戏开发中对数据管理的需求也在不断增加,PG电子机制作为一种先进的数据管理方案,逐渐成为游戏开发中的核心工具,本文将深入探讨PG电子机制的基本概念、实现方式及其在游戏开发中的应用。


PG电子机制的基本概念

PG电子机制是一种基于数据库的解决方案,旨在为游戏开发提供高效的数据管理能力,它通过将游戏数据存储在数据库中,并通过特定的接口和工具实现数据的管理和访问,PG电子机制的核心目标是确保游戏数据的高效存储、快速访问和数据的安全性。

在游戏开发中,PG电子机制通常用于以下几个方面:

  1. 数据持久化:将游戏数据存储在数据库中,确保数据在程序重启或设备重启后仍然可用。
  2. 版本控制:支持对游戏数据的不同版本进行管理,便于在开发过程中回滚或更新游戏内容。
  3. 数据安全:通过加密和权限控制,确保游戏数据的安全性。
  4. 数据访问:提供标准化的接口,方便开发者访问和操作游戏数据。

PG电子机制的实现方式

PG电子机制的实现通常涉及以下几个步骤:

  1. 数据模型设计:根据游戏的需求设计数据模型,确定需要存储的数据类型和关系,一个简单的角色数据模型可能包括角色ID、名称、等级、属性等字段。
  2. 数据库选择:根据数据模型和性能需求选择合适的数据库,常见的数据库类型包括关系型数据库(如MySQL、PostgreSQL)和非关系型数据库(如MongoDB)。
  3. 数据存储:将游戏数据存储在数据库中,并通过PG电子机制提供的API进行管理和操作。
  4. 数据访问:通过游戏引擎提供的API访问游戏数据,进行更新、查询或删除操作。

PG电子机制在游戏开发中的应用

PG电子机制在游戏开发中的应用非常广泛,以下是其主要应用场景:

游戏数据管理

PG电子机制可以用来管理游戏中的各种数据,包括角色数据、物品数据、技能数据等,通过将这些数据存储在数据库中,开发者可以方便地进行数据的增删改查操作。

在《英雄联盟》中,PG电子机制可以用来管理每个玩家的属性(如血量、 mana、技能槽等),这些数据可以通过数据库进行高效管理。

版本控制

PG电子机制支持对游戏数据的不同版本进行管理,开发者可以通过版本控制功能,回滚游戏数据到之前的版本,避免因代码错误导致的数据丢失。

数据安全

PG电子机制通常内置了数据加密和权限控制功能,确保游戏数据的安全性,开发者可以通过设置访问权限,限制外部用户或不同角色的访问范围。

数据性能优化

通过优化数据库设计和查询性能,PG电子机制可以显著提升游戏数据的访问速度和整体性能,使用索引优化查询性能,避免因数据冗余导致的性能瓶颈。

跨平台支持

PG电子机制支持跨平台开发,开发者可以使用不同的数据库和平台(如Unity、 Unreal Engine等)来管理游戏数据,通过跨平台的支持,开发者可以将游戏数据统一管理,避免在不同平台上出现数据不一致的问题。


PG电子机制的优缺点

PG电子机制作为游戏数据管理的重要工具,具有许多优点,但也存在一些缺点。

优点:

  1. 数据安全:通过加密和权限控制,确保游戏数据的安全性。
  2. 数据持久化:确保游戏数据在重启或设备重启后仍然可用。
  3. 版本控制:支持对游戏数据的不同版本进行管理,便于回滚和更新。
  4. 数据性能优化:通过优化数据库设计和查询性能,提升游戏的整体性能。

缺点:

  1. 学习曲线:PG电子机制的使用需要一定的数据库知识,对于不熟悉数据库的开发者来说,学习成本较高。
  2. 维护复杂性:随着游戏功能的扩展,游戏数据也会随之增加,导致数据库设计和维护变得更加复杂。
  3. 跨平台限制:虽然支持跨平台,但在实际应用中可能需要额外的配置和调整。

PG电子机制的未来发展

随着游戏技术的不断发展,PG电子机制也在不断进步,PG电子机制可能会更加智能化,支持更多的功能,如数据可视化、数据监控等,随着人工智能和大数据技术的应用,PG电子机制在游戏数据管理中的作用也会更加重要。


PG电子机制作为游戏开发中的核心数据管理方案,为游戏数据的高效管理和安全提供了强有力的支持,通过合理设计数据模型、优化数据库性能和加强数据安全,PG电子机制可以显著提升游戏的整体性能和用户体验,随着技术的不断进步,PG电子机制将在游戏开发中发挥更加重要的作用。

PG电子机制,游戏开发中的核心数据管理方案pg电子机制,

发表评论